Wet Basement Repair in Montgomery, AL
Wet basement repair services focus on addressing issues caused by water intrusion in below-ground levels of residential properties. These projects typically involve identifying sources of moisture, such as leaks, poor drainage, or foundation cracks, and implementing solutions like sealing walls, installing drainage systems, or applying waterproof coatings. Property owners often seek this service to prevent further damage, reduce mold growth, and protect the structural integrity of their homes,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high groundwater levels.
Before requesting wet basement repair,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of water intrusion, the underlying causes, and the best methods for mitigation. Clarifying whether the repairs are cosmetic or structural, and understanding the long-term effectiveness of different solutions, can help property owners make informed decisions. Proper assessment and planning are essential to ensure that water issues are thoroughly resolved and that the basement remains dry and secure over time.

Common Wet Basement Repair Jobs
Basement wa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and keeps basement areas dry.
Crack repair - addresses foundation cracks that can lead to leaks and structural issues.
Drainage solutions - improves exterior and interior drainage to reduce basement moisture.
Sump pump installation - removes excess water to protect against flooding in the basement.
Wall sealing and insulation - helps prevent moisture buildup and mold growth inside the basement.
Waterproof paint application - creates a moisture-resistant barrier on basement walls.
Wet Basement Repair Questions
What causes a basement to become wet? Excess moisture from groundwater, poor drainage, or cracks in the foundation can lead to a wet basement.
How can wet basements be rep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, installing drainage systems, or applying waterproof coatings to prevent water intrusion.
Is waterproofing necessary for all basements? Waterproofing is recommended when there is persistent moisture or water seepage to protect the foundation and interior spaces.
What signs indicate a basement needs repair? Signs include damp walls, mold growth, a musty odor, or visible water stains on basement surfaces.
